N.D. Cent. Code § 10-15-55

Defense of ultra vires

Known as the North Dakota Cooperative Association Act

The act spans §§ 10–10 (80 sections).

No act and no transfer of property to or by a cooperative is invalid because made in excess of the cooperative's power, except that such lack of power may be asserted in a proceeding by:

1. A member, stockholder, or director against the cooperative to enjoin any act or any transfer of property to or by the cooperative.

2. The cooperative or its legal representative against any present or former officer or director.

3. The attorney general against the cooperative in an action to dissolve the cooperative or to enjoin it from the transaction of unauthorized business.
